Tokyo Stocks Turn Down on Profit-Taking in Morning

Tokyo, Aug. 14 (Jiji Press)–Tokyo stocks turned lower Thursday morning, with many issues succumbing to profit-taking following the key Nikkei 225 and TOPIX indexes’ six-session rallies through Wednesday.
